The Flame and the Arrow
1950 · 88 MIN · IMDB 6.8 · 4,398 VOTES · DIR. Jacques Tourneur
Overview
Dardo, a Robin Hood-like figure, and his loyal followers use a Roman ruin in Medieval Lombardy as their headquarters as they conduct an insurgency against their Hessian conquerors.
